GCC CONTEXT
Political and economic developments in Qatar have historically influenced regional stability, sovereign credit metrics, and hydrocarbon export dynamics across GCC markets, particularly given Qatar's role as a major liquefied natural gas (LNG) producer and its integration into Gulf financial and energy infrastructure. Domestic policy shifts, fiscal allocations, and labor market conditions in Qatar tend to have spillover effects on regional currency pegs, cross-border investment flows, and energy commodity pricing. Structural factors including Qatar's sovereign wealth fund activities, banking sector health, and infrastructure spending patterns remain closely monitored as indicators of broader GCC economic momentum and geopolitical risk premiums.
